Common Signs You Are Dealing with Sciatica
The sciatic nerve is the longest in your body, traveling from your lower back, through the hips, and down each leg. You can distinguish true nerve impingement from simple muscle soreness by the way the sensation travels. Muscle pain usually stays in one spot. True sciatica often feels like a hot or tingling "zip" of electricity that radiates toward your foot. Mindful Movement for Nerve Flossing
Nerve flossing is a gentle technique designed to improve the mobility of the sciatic nerve without causing irritation. Sit on a firm chair with your feet flat. Slowly straighten one leg while tilting your head back to look at the ceiling. As you bring your foot back down, tuck your chin toward your chest. This rhythmic gliding prevents the nerve from getting snagged on surrounding tissues. Repeat this 5 to 10 times. It's a powerful way to relieve sciatic pressure by promoting circulation and reducing inflammation around the nerve root.
Pair this movement with diaphragmatic breathing. Inhale deeply into your belly for four counts, then exhale slowly for six. This simple breathwork pattern activates the parasympathetic nervous system. It lowers cortisol levels and reduces the chemical triggers of pain. When you breathe deeply, you're telling your body that it's safe to relax.

What is the difference between sciatica and general lower back pain?
Sciatica is specifically defined by pain that radiates along the sciatic nerve, often reaching past the knee and into the foot. General lower back pain usually stays localized in the lumbar region. Do I need a GP referral to see a chiropractor in Sydney?
You don't need a GP referral to visit our Sydney clinic as chiropractors are primary healthcare providers in Australia. You can book your visit directly to start your journey toward wellness. If you're looking for a Medicare rebate under a Chronic Disease Management plan, your GP must provide a specific referral form first. Currently, this plan can cover up to 5 subsidised visits per calendar year for eligible residents.
